Electrical computers and digital processing systems: interprogra – Application program interface
Reexamination Certificate
2005-12-23
2010-06-08
Wu, Qing-Yuan (Department: 2194)
Electrical computers and digital processing systems: interprogra
Application program interface
C709S212000, C709S213000, C709S214000, C709S215000, C709S216000, C710S052000, C710S056000, C711S147000, C711S148000, C711S149000
Reexamination Certificate
active
07735099
ABSTRACT:
Method and system for a network for receiving and sending network packets is provided. The system includes a host processor that executes an operating system for a host system and at least one application that runs in a context that is different from a context of the operating system; and a network adapter with a hardware device that can run a network protocol stack, wherein the application can access the network adapter directly via an application specific interface layer without using the operating system and the application designates a named memory buffer for a network connection and when data is received by the network adapter for the network connection, then the network adapter passes the received data directly to the designated named buffer.
REFERENCES:
patent: 5390299 (1995-02-01), Rege et al.
patent: 6272551 (2001-08-01), Martin et al.
patent: 6678734 (2004-01-01), Haatainen et al.
patent: 6859867 (2005-02-01), Berry
patent: 6976174 (2005-12-01), Terrell et al.
patent: 7385974 (2008-06-01), Elzur
patent: 7400639 (2008-07-01), Madukkarumukumana et al.
patent: 7460473 (2008-12-01), Kodama et al.
patent: 7493427 (2009-02-01), Freimuth et al.
patent: 7523179 (2009-04-01), Chu et al.
patent: 2003/0212735 (2003-11-01), Hicok et al.
patent: 2003/0214909 (2003-11-01), Maciel
patent: 2004/0047361 (2004-03-01), Fan et al.
patent: 2004/0057380 (2004-03-01), Biran et al.
patent: 2005/0021680 (2005-01-01), Ekis et al.
patent: 2005/0135415 (2005-06-01), Fan et al.
patent: 2005/0144402 (2005-06-01), Beverly
patent: 2005/0198410 (2005-09-01), Kagan et al.
patent: 2005/0276281 (2005-12-01), Jones
patent: 2006/0015651 (2006-01-01), Freimuth et al.
patent: 2006/0031524 (2006-02-01), Freimuth et al.
patent: 2006/0034283 (2006-02-01), Ko et al.
patent: 2006/0067346 (2006-03-01), Tucker et al.
patent: 2006/0092934 (2006-05-01), Chung et al.
patent: 2006/0193317 (2006-08-01), Rajagopalan et al.
patent: 2007/0014245 (2007-01-01), Aloni et al.
patent: 2007/0033301 (2007-02-01), Aloni et al.
patent: 2007/0162639 (2007-07-01), Chu et al.
patent: 2007/0255802 (2007-11-01), Aloni et al.
patent: 2008/0235484 (2008-09-01), Tal et al.
“Office Action from USPTO dated Jul. 17, 2008 for U.S. Appl. No. 11/223,693”.
“Office Action from USPTO dated Oct. 10, 2008 for U.S. Appl. No. 11/222,594”.
“Final Office Action from USPTO dated Dec. 11, 2008 for U.S. Appl. No. 11/223,693”.
“Final Office Action from USPTO dated Apr. 17, 2009 for U.S. Appl. No. 11/222,594”.
“Office Action from USPTO dated May 13, 2009 for U.S. Appl. No. 11/223,693”.
“Office Action from USPTO dated Aug. 14, 2009 for U.S. Appl. No. 11/222,594”.
“Notice of Allowance from USPTO dated Nov. 10, 2009 for U.S. Appl. No. 11/223,693”.
“Final Office Action from USPTO dated Mar. 10, 2010 for U.S. Appl. No. 11/222,594”.
Klein O'Neill & Singh, LLP
QLOGIC Corporation
Wu Qing-Yuan
LandOfFree
Method and system for processing network data does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with Method and system for processing network data,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Method and system for processing network data will most certainly appreciate the feedback.
Profile ID: LFUS-PAI-O-4239205